Output 99d618d61c32dc3b38a6aaeaf2e793ffe49da185cf82b9769833496f677573fb:1

value
5578370
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ef3ec573d0ee4e07a85084e78aacb3ae79db84ec OP_EQUALVERIFY OP_CHECKSIG
address
1Np1hGstcvGbDB3D74yT6Cue9LiY9iMuxC
transaction
99d618d61c32dc3b38a6aaeaf2e793ffe49da185cf82b9769833496f677573fb
spent
true